CLAIM: $6 billion went missing from the U.S. State Department while Hillary Clinton was in charge.
WHAT'S TRUE: An inspector general's report criticized Hillary Clinton's State Department for improper record keeping on $6 billion in government contracts.
WHAT'S FALSE: The $6 billion was never "lost," "missing," or "misplaced."

http://www.politifact.com/florida/s...-trump-wrongly-blames-hillary-clinton-creati/

CLAIM: Clinton and Obama created ISIS:

Our ruling
Trump said "Hillary Clinton invented ISIS with her stupid policies. She is responsible for ISIS."

There were several factors that contributed to the growing power of ISIS, but it’s misleading to pin the responsibility solely on Clinton. For starters, the roots of ISIS trace back to 2004, when Bush was president and before Clinton was Obama’s secretary of state.

She did vote to authorize force in Iraq in 2002 while a senator, but that was advocated by the Bush administration and the vast majority of senators. The intervention in Libya, which she supported, did give ISIS an opening, but Trump is overstating her role by saying she is responsible for ISIS.

This claim is inaccurate. We rate it False.

CLAIM: Clinton has rigged the election:

Our ruling

Trump has repeatedly claimed that the U.S. election system is rigged.

He has cited examples of voter fraud, which is extremely rare, often unintentional and not on a scale large enough to affect a national election.

While there are isolated examples of bought local elections, experts say it cannot be replicated on a national scale. While it is possible to tamper with electronic voting machines, there is no evidence deliberate malfeasance has altered any election.
We rate Trump’s claim Pants on Fire.

Pence claimed that Clinton "took 13 hours to send help to Americans under fire."

In fact, it wasn’t Clinton’s responsibility to send troops to the scene — the military chain of command took that responsibility. The Defense Department attempted to send help to the scene, but was unable to reach Benghazi before the deaths occurred.

Pence implied that Clinton dawdled before sending help to Americans in danger. That is not accurate. We rate this claim False.
